The Humanitarian Arrives — Let Go of What You’ve Outgrown


Yesterday’s Universal Day 8 put power back in your hands. You rebuilt. You organized. You stood in your authority after the week’s relentless inner excavation. Now Universal Day 9 walks in with a completely different agenda: release. The 9 is the final single digit, the number of completion and compassion, and it asks you to stop holding on to whatever has finished serving you. Inside Universal Month 7, that release goes deeper than spring cleaning — it touches the beliefs, identities, and emotional contracts you’ve been carrying long past their expiration date.

The 9 is the Humanitarian. It sees the bigger picture. Where the 8 built for personal power, the 9 builds for collective good. Where the 8 asked what you could achieve, the 9 asks what you can contribute. This Thursday carries that outward-facing energy — a pull toward generosity, service, and the kind of giving that doesn’t keep score.

But the 9 doesn’t just give. It also releases. And that’s where today gets interesting. The compound 18 — today’s full numerological signature — reduces to 9, but it passes through the territory of the 1 and the 8 first. Beginnings and power. Individuality and authority. You’re releasing these not because they failed, but because a version of them has completed its cycle.

Think about what that means inside a Universal Year 1. You’re simultaneously in a year of fresh starts and a day of endings. That’s not a contradiction. It’s the breath between exhale and inhale. You can’t take in new air until you’ve emptied your lungs.

Universal Month 7 gives this release unusual depth. The Seeker’s month doesn’t do anything on the surface. When the 7 releases, it releases understanding — outdated frameworks, spiritual assumptions, intellectual positions that felt true once but now just feel heavy. Notice which beliefs you’re defending out of habit rather than conviction.

In relationships, the 9 is profoundly compassionate but not sentimental. It can love someone and still acknowledge that a dynamic between you has run its course. This doesn’t necessarily mean endings — more often, it means releasing the version of the relationship that both of you have outgrown. Letting go of who you were together so you can discover who you’re becoming.

The 9 Day carries a certain emotional fullness. You might feel nostalgic, tender, or quietly moved by things that wouldn’t normally register. A conversation with a stranger. A memory surfacing without warning. A sudden awareness of how interconnected everything is. The Humanitarian doesn’t just think about connection — it feels it.

There’s a generosity impulse here that’s worth following. Not grand gestures — the 7 month doesn’t do grand. More like quiet acts of kindness that cost you nothing but attention. Letting someone go ahead of you. Listening without planning your response. Offering the kind of presence that most people are too busy to give.

The shadow of the 9 is martyrdom. Giving until you’re empty and calling it virtue. Releasing things you actually need because surrender sounds spiritual. The 9 asks for genuine completion, not performative sacrifice. If something is still alive in you — a project, a relationship, a dream — the 9 doesn’t demand you bury it prematurely.

Coming off the past ten days of this month — initiation, illumination, karmic tests, ego collapse, and rebuilding — today feels like a natural exhale. You’ve been through something. The 9 recognizes that and asks you to integrate it. Not by analyzing it to death (the 7 month’s temptation) but by simply letting the experience settle into your body and your being.

There’s wisdom in the 18/9 compound that’s worth noting. The 18 in many numerological traditions carries themes of spiritual testing through material challenge. It suggests that what you’re releasing today may involve something tangible — a possession, a financial arrangement, a role or title that no longer reflects who you are.

The 9 is also the number of the artist and the visionary. If creative expression calls to you today, answer. The combination of the 7 month’s depth and the 9‘s expansive compassion can produce writing, music, or art that touches something universal. You don’t have to be a professional creator to feel this — even a journal entry or a heartfelt message to someone you appreciate counts.

Tomorrow, the cycle resets. Universal Day 1 arrives to begin again. Today is the threshold — the liminal space between what was and what’s next. Stand in it without rushing through. The 9 doesn’t hurry. It takes the long view, knowing that every ending carries the seed of something new.

Let completion be enough. You don’t need to replace what you release. You don’t need to fill the space immediately. The 7 month and the 9 day agree on this: emptiness isn’t failure. It’s capacity. It’s the open hands that can finally receive.
